The ticket facilities at West Hampstead Thameslink are designed to cater to every traveler’s needs. The ticket office operates from early morning to late evening, providing convenience for those early commutes or late-night returns. For tech-savvy travelers, ticket machines are readily available, offering the capability to collect tickets purchased online. Moreover, advanced systems like smartcard issuance and validation are in practice, ensuring a swift transition from station to train.
The station boasts step-free access throughout, making it accessible for everyone, including those with mobility issues. Assistance can be pre-booked or availed on arrival, ensuring that every passenger experiences a smooth journey. Though the station lacks accessible toilets and waiting rooms, its commitment to accessibility is evident, with induction loops, ramps for train access, and seating areas abundantly available.
Ensuring optimal convenience, West Hampstead Thameslink is well-integrated with diverse transport links. With accessible entry and exit points and customer help points, getting to and from the station is smooth. While there is no provision for cycle hire, the station offers 42 bicycle storage spaces fitted with CCTV for added security.

Wargrave train station is a quaint stop in Berkshire on the Henley Branch Line, nestled amidst the tranquil English countryside. Though small, it serves the charming village of Wargrave and the neighbouring areas, offering easy access to some of the most bustling and historic UK cities. The station is relatively modest, lacking some of the larger amenities found in more central locations. 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ets conveniently, ensuring you're all set for your journey. While there is no manned ticket office, the machines are accessible, catering to diverse needs with the induction loop available for those with hearing impairments.
Accessibility is a priority at Wargrave, with step-free access throughout the station, making it easy for those with mobility challenges to navigate. Although there's no waiting room, there is a seating area for a cozy wait for your train. Unfortunately, the station doesn't feature refreshment facilities or shopping options, so grabbing a coffee beforehand might be wise.
Fret not if you arrive with luggage or are concerned about safety, as CCTV coverage provides an added layer of security. For more assistance, customer help points are available, and information is also accessible via display screens or general announcements.
When planning onward travel from Wargrave station, options abound. Although there’s no taxi rank directly at the station, reliable bus services frequently venture from the high street nearby, seamlessly connecting you to other destinations. For those journeying to the airport, changing at Reading or nearby connections may be necessary to reach Heathrow, Gatwick, or even Bristol Airport.
If you're a cycling enthusiast, storage for bicycles is available, albeit limited, just adjacent to the platform entrance. This sets up perfect convenience for a seamless commute or even a leisurely ride through the picturesque Wargrave surroundings.
